Mar 20Solar Eclipse 20247:00pmOn April 8th, there will be a total eclipse of the Sun visible in the United States on a line from Maine to Texas. This is a truly rare and spectacular astronomical event and should not be missed! Learn about the history of eclipses, how and why they happen, where the best viewing locations are and how to prepare for observing this amazing celestial display of nature!
Join us as we host local amateur astronomer Paul Cirillo as he shares everything we need to know as we prepare for this astonishing cosmic event. All attendees will receive a pair of solar glasses to watch the live eclipse on April 8th!
